Innovative all-in-one solution for daily use:
The multifunctional disinfectant solution Opti-Free PureMoist was specially adapted to the needs of silicone hydrogel contact lenses. This effective all-in-one solution cleans, disinfects, removes proteins and lipids, and is suitable for storing all soft contact lenses. Thanks to its biocompatible disinfectant action, Opti-Free PureMoist can effectively reduce fungi and germs, thus ensuring extremely hygienic contact lens care. The integrated HydraGlyde Moisture Matrix is an innovative ingredient that coats the contact lens with moisture and ensures particularly long-lasting hydration. Opti-Free PureMoist thus provides contact lens wearers with a comfortable wearing experience from morning to night.
Ingredients:
Polyquad 0.001%, Aldox 0.0006%, HydraGlyde, Sodium Citrate, Tetronic 1304, Boric Acid.
Recommended use:
Before placing the contact lenses in the lens case, manual pre-cleaning is required. Manual cleaning breaks down the layer of contamination on the contact lens, allowing the solution to remove unwanted deposits during thorough rinsing. Place the contact lens in the palm of your washed hand, apply a few drops of the All-In-One solution, and gently rub each side of the lens in a star pattern from the center to the edge with your fingertip for 10 seconds. Finally, place your cleaned contact lenses in a contact lens case filled with the All-In-One solution for disinfection and storage. The package insert for your contact lens care product will tell you how long you can leave the lenses in the solution for disinfection and when each care step must be repeated. After inserting the lenses, the solution in the lens case must be disposed of. Do not rinse the case with water; let it air dry. Once a week, in the morning after removing your lenses, fill the lens case with fresh all-in-one solution, screw it shut, and leave it upside down throughout the day to disinfect the lids. This solution is also discarded and replaced in the evening before inserting the worn lenses.
